Ohio Gov. John Kasich has appointed a new trustee to the 11-member Wright State University Board of Trustees.
Stephanie E. Green of Columbus was appointed for a term beginning July 1, 2017, and ending June 30, 2026. She replaces Eloise P. Broner, whose term ended June 30, 2017.
A Columbus native, Green attended Hampton University in Hampton, Virginia, where she received a Bachelor of Science in Business Management and Finance.
After graduation, Green joined Fifth Third Bank, where she has enjoyed a diverse 28-year career. She currently serves as senior vice president and director of Fifth Third Private Banking – Central Ohio Region.
Maintaining community relationships established early in her career, Green serves on several boards and commissions, including on the African American Leadership Academy, the Ohio Fair Plan Underwriting Association Board of Governors and as treasurer of the Columbus Association of the Performing Arts. She previously served as president of the board of directors of CompDrug, Inc., the North Side Child and Family Development Center and the Columbus Regional Minority Supplier Development Council and as a member of Columbus Board of Realtors, Affordable Housing Committee.
Green and her husband, Jack, live in the Columbus area and have two adult children.
